Crypto Market Adjusts Rapidly to Interest Rate Changes

The cryptocurrency market has demonstrated a heightened sensitivity to shifts in interest rate expectations, outpacing other asset classes in its response. Recent observations from Wintermute reveal that the abrupt decline in December rate-cut probabilities has prompted a swift recalibration among investors. The publication provides the following information: this recalibration is indicative of the market's increasing volatility and responsiveness to macroeconomic factors.

Wintermute Highlights Crypto Market Sensitivity

According to Wintermute, the rapid adjustment in the crypto market underscores its status as the most rate-sensitive sector. Investors have had to react quickly to the changing landscape, leading to more pronounced fluctuations in cryptocurrency prices compared to traditional stocks.

Impact of Macroeconomic Factors on Cryptocurrency

This phenomenon illustrates the intricate relationship between macroeconomic factors and the performance of risk assets, emphasizing the need for investors to stay vigilant in a volatile environment.
